Key Trends Shaping the Market

  1. Sustainability at the Forefront
    • Consumers and regulators alike are pushing for recyclable, biodegradável, and plant-based films. Suppliers like Lacerta Group e Trioworld are pioneering materials with up to 30% recycled content, reducing plastic waste without compromising performance.
    • Inovações como Seal N’ Flip™—a bottom-lidding film design—cut plastic use by 20% while enhancing product visibility, a trend adopted by retailers like Walmart and Kroger for grab-and-go sections.
  2. Smart Packaging Technologies
    • AI-driven quality monitoring and freshness indicators are being integrated into films. Por exemplo, Tecpacking Group’s oxygen-scavenging films extend shelf life by 50% for perishables like meat and seafood.(Embalagem de alimentos
    • RTG Films specializes in high-barrier lock-seal films that maintain freshness for bakery items and processed cheeses, leveraging multilayer structures to block moisture and oxygen.(Embalagem de alimentos
  3. Customization for Diverse Applications
    • From frozen food para ready-to-eat meals, Embalagem de alimentos suppliers offer tailored solutions. Profol Americas provides anti-fog films for refrigerated produce and peelable lidding for microwaveable trays, ensuring convenience across food categories.
    • Oliver Packaging’s Speedseal Films cater to paper and plastic trays, with gauges adjustable for snacks or full-course meals, streamlining operations for foodservice giants like Sysco and Compass Group.

Challenges and Opportunities

While the market thrives, suppliers face hurdles:

  • Material Costs: Fluctuating prices for biodegradable resins like PLA and PHA.
  • Conformidade Regulatória: Navigating varying standards across regions (Por exemplo, EU’s Single-Use Plastics Directive vs. FDA guidelines).

Ainda, these challenges spur innovation. Por exemplo, Zhejiang Haibin’s hybrid films blend bio-based polymers with traditional plastics, balancing cost and sustainability.
